Abstract
A multi-mode audio scrambling system includes an all-pass filter and a 90 degree phase shift circuit for supplying balanced modulators with 90 degree phase displaced audio information and 90 degree phase displaced carriers derived from the horizontal line frequency of a television receiver for producing a single sideband, suppressed carrier audio spectrum. A plurality of offset frequencies are derived from the horizontal line frequency and are used to further modulate the resultant signal to produce a single sideband displaced audio spectrum. A logic circuit selects the offset frequency (mode) in response to vertical interval signals, video inversion signals and audio tone or data signals. The final output is thus scrambled in different modes with different offset frequencies. A complementary unscrambling system is also described.
